Is 37 061 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 37 061 is about 192.512.

Thus, the square root of 37 061 is not an integer, and therefore 37 061 is not a square number.

Anyway, 37 061 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 37 061?

The square of a number (here 37 061) is the result of the product of this number (37 061) by itself (i.e., 37 061 × 37 061); the square of 37 061 is sometimes called "raising 37 061 to the power 2", or "37 061 squared".

The square of 37 061 is 1 373 517 721 because 37 061 × 37 061 = 37 0612 = 1 373 517 721.

As a consequence, 37 061 is the square root of 1 373 517 721.
